Senior Financial Billing Analyst

What does a successful Finance Billing Analyst, Senior do?

In this role, you will ensure that colleagues and clients receive responsive, diligent, and outstanding support for a wide variety of revenue impacting transactions. You will directly impact both client experience and help Fiserv achieve results by monitoring, processing, implementing, and recording complex transactions.

What You Will Do

Review, analyze complex and multi-business unit client contracts for proper billing set up; work with account management and product teams to ensure client is billed as expected. Assume ownership of billing processes for an assigned book of business, including contract analysis, data preparation, billing, and variance trending. Create and maintain ETL (extract, transform and load) processes to accumulate source data from multiple sources, maintain contract rates, invoice and credit memo issuance within ERP system. Prepare quantitative analysis, qualitative business judgement, build strong relationships with key decision makers and peers across the business units. Engage in annual audit and quarterly reviews as requested. Enhance efficiencies within the Finance Shared Services processes by systems, automation tools, and resources.

What You Will Need To Have

Bachelor’s degree in accounting, Finance, Mathematics, Computer Science, or Data Analytics. 3+ years of experience in Finance, Data Analytics, Accounting and/or Billing. Advanced Excel experience such as working with Macros, pivot tables, filters, etc. Also, Windows applications and Access.

What Would Be Great To Have

Prior experience with large ERPs such as SAP, Oracle or Peoplesoft. Ability to collect, aggregate, analyze and interpret data. Prior experience with automation tools such as Alteryx, Power Automate and Power BI. Experience acting as a liaison with Clients and other departments, divisions, and organizations.
